VIDEO: Police Arrest Alleged Armed Man in Newark

Newark Police officials are reporting the arrest of Mr. Laquan Walker, 36, of Newark, who was observed with a handgun while walking toward a man he had been quarreling with last night. Police say the incident was captured on body worn camera.

“I am grateful that these officers took command of a situation that could have ended in a tragedy,” Director Ambrose said.

“Newark Officers, who are still in field training, likely averted a shooting and may have saved a man’s life. Our neighborhoods are safer thanks to the presence and quick actions of these officers. They each exhibited great restraint and should be commended,” he added.

Just before 8:55 p.m., three Community Focus Team members pulled into the Exxon Gas Station at 397 Springfield Avenue and heard two men arguing loudly. Officers observed one of the men remove a handgun from his person while approaching the man he was arguing with.

The shortened video shows Walker with his hands in the air and no weapon is seen on the captured body cam video sent by Newark Police officials.

Officials say the three officers each unholstered their service weapons and arrested the suspect, Laquan Walker, without incident. No injuries have been reported.

Walker faces charges of unlawful weapon possession and certain persons prohibited from weapon possession.

These charges are merely accusations. This suspect is presumed innocent until proven guilty in a court of law.
